STEM Around Brooklyn
PreK
PreK used 3D foam pieces to build structures!
Kindergarten
Kindergarten did an experiment to see if mittens are warm!
First Grade
First grade has been learning about different types of rocks, fossils, and dinosaurs!
Second Grade
2nd grade celebrated the 102nd day of school by dressing as dalmatians, eating black and white snacks, and watching Disney's 102 Dalmatians!
Third Grade
3rd grade continued to work on simple machines this week. They built incline planes, pulleys, and levers. Now to build a compound machine to save the tiger!
Fourth Grade
4th graders are exploring energy. They created a circuit with energy sticks. They discovered that when they all held hands, the sticks would light up and make a sound! When we let go of our hands, the lights and sounds turned off.

School Wide Title 1
Funding has been made available through School Wide Title 1 Services to Brooklyn STEM Academy for the purpose of providing students with extra support in reading/language arts and math. This extra support is available for all students at Brooklyn STEM Academy. Classroom teachers, Title 1 Teachers and instructional aides provide assistance through small group and individualized instruction as children demonstrate a need for support. Please contact your teacher about services your child may receive.
